From Civil Engineering to Carpentry
When I was a little boy, I loved to build complex structures, whether it was with Lincoln Logs or Lego. I thoroughly enjoyed working with my hands. That love of building grew with me, and I went on to get a Bachelor of Science in Civil Engineering.
I worked for several years as a civil engineer, but it left me unfulfilled. It wasn’t hands-on enough for me. So I shifted over to carpentry. I enjoy the mathematical challenges as much as the physicality of the work — I wanted to build the thing, not just draw it.
That is why I started this business. My mission is to build beautiful things.
— John Paul Morton, Owner

Why the Name
Tekton is the Greek word for artisan, or craftsman. It is what the business is named after, and what it is measured against.

The Tekton Standard — Five Pillars
Installation Discipline
Defined installation standards without shortcuts. Footings, spans and fastener patterns are specified before anyone picks up a tool, not judged by eye on the day.
Intentional Design Detail
Layout and finish are planned, not improvised. Board direction, border placement and where the seams land are decided in advance, because they are the details you look at for the next twenty years.
Long-Term Durability
Material selection based on longevity in this climate. Oregon’s wet winters and UV-heavy summers punish the wrong choices, and the wrong choice is usually invisible until the third year.
Fixed-Price Clarity
Clear scope before execution. Every board, fastener, joist and post cap is listed in the proposal, and if the scope does not change, the price does not change.
Professional Communication
Organized, calm process from start to finish. You will know what is happening on your project and who is doing it.
Our 5-Year Structural Guarantee
Every Tekton deck comes with a written five-year structural guarantee covering the structure we build — framing, footings, fasteners and connections. Decking and railing products carry their own manufacturer warranties on top of that.
